Where does the money I’m paying go?

Financial Distribution

Course management: 20%

  • Admin duties/Operations

    • Emails/communications

    • Billing

    • Misc

  • Creative/Marketing

  • Operations

Co Facilitators (2): 40%

  • Facilitator: course creation, space holding, flow

  • Co-Facilitator: somatic offerings, space holding

Guest Contributors (3-4): 15-20%

  • Course planning

  • Admin/Communication

  • 1 hour contribution

  • Sharing/promotion of course (optional)

HypoFutures: 20%

  • Operational fees

    • zoom, website, taxes (ugh), etc

    • Future Fiber Arts studio investments (equipment, contracts, operations)

Do you offer scholarships?

We will offer at least 1 full scholarship and 1 half scholarship per cohort. Applications for scholarship are open, and applicants will be notified before the course begins. More scholarships will be available dependent on enrollment tiers. Fill out this form to apply for a scholarship.
